De La Warr Pavilion, Bexhill-on-Sea As a gallerist, she represented painters like Jackson Pollock – but her own work, which she did at weekends, is deliciously bold and breezy.
Textile art, often regarded as a peripheral craft, is currently riding a wave of critical appreciation. After ‘Unravelled’ at the Barbican and Tadek Beutlich at the Ditchling Museum of Art & Craft, the De La Warr Pavilion in Bexhill is the latest to catch the wave.
